How to Successfully Organize a Reunion Dance Party

Organizing a reunion dance party is a fantastic way to reconnect with old friends and relive memorable moments from the past. It’s an opportunity to dance, laugh, and share stories while celebrating the bonds you’ve forged over the years. To ensure your event is a resounding success, follow these steps to plan and execute a fantastic reunion dance party.

1. Define the Purpose and Scope

Before you start planning, clarify the purpose of the dance party. Is it a way to celebrate a milestone birthday, a high school reunion, or a simply a gathering of friends? Determining the scope will help you set the tone and expectations for the event.

2. Create a Guest List

Compile a list of potential guests, considering factors such as their interest in attending a dance party and their connection to the group. Ensure you include a diverse range of friends to create a lively and inclusive atmosphere.

3. Choose the Right Venue

Select a venue that can accommodate your guest list and provide ample space for dancing. Consider the following options:

  • Local community center
  • Event space or banquet hall
  • School gym or auditorium
  • Outdoor venue (e.g., park, beach, or garden)

When choosing a venue, ensure it has the necessary amenities, such as sound equipment, lighting, and a dance floor or ample space to dance.

4. Set a Date and Time

Decide on a date and time that works for the majority of your guests. Consider their schedules and any potential conflicts. It’s also essential to plan for the event’s duration, ensuring there’s enough time for dancing, socializing, and perhaps a meal or snack.

5. Plan the Music Playlist

Create a playlist that reflects the era or styles of music that your group enjoys. You can compile a mix of popular songs from the past, current hits, and timeless classics. Don’t forget to include a mix of genres to cater to different tastes and keep the dance floor buzzing.

6. Hire a DJ or DJ Equipment

If you don’t have a DJ, consider hiring one for your reunion dance party. A professional DJ can keep the energy high and ensure a smooth flow of music. Alternatively, you can rent DJ equipment and have a friend or family member DJ the event.

7. Arrange for Catering

Decide whether you want to provide your own food and drinks or hire a caterer. Options include a buffet, a plated dinner, or finger food. Ensure that there are enough options to cater to different dietary restrictions and preferences.

8. Decorate the Venue

Create a festive atmosphere by decorating the venue with items that represent your group’s shared history. Consider using:

  • Banners or signs with funny memories or inside jokes
  • Vintage photographs or posters from your era
  • Custom centerpieces and table decorations
  • String lights or lanterns to create a cozy ambiance

9. Organize Games and Activities

Plan some games or activities to keep the energy high and provide opportunities for guests to interact. Consider:

  • Dance-offs
  • Karaoke
  • Photo booth with props
  • Trivia games related to your shared history

10. Prepare for Unexpected Challenges

Be prepared for any unexpected challenges that may arise. Have a backup plan for inclement weather if your event is outdoors, and ensure you have a contingency plan for technical difficulties with sound and lighting.

11. Follow-Up

After the event, follow up with your guests to express your gratitude and ask for feedback. This will help you improve future events and maintain the strong bonds you’ve forged through the reunion dance party.
